What they do

A Mental or Behavioral Health Social Worker assesses and treats individuals with mental, emotional, or substance abuse problems. Activities may include individual and group therapy, crisis intervention, case management, client advocacy, prevention, and education.

Job Description

Qualifications:

Master's degree in Psychology, Counseling, Social Work, or a related human services field from an accredited university. Active licensure (or license-eligible, depending on state requirements) required for providing telehealth services. Conduct comprehensive remote assessments to evaluate adult clients' mental health, substance use (alcohol and drugs), and emotional functioning via secure telehealth platforms. Provide individual and group therapy sessions through virtual modalities, using evidence-based practices tailored to substance use and co-occurring disorders. Develop, implement, and regularly update individualized treatment plans in collaboration with clients, ensuring continuity of care in a virtual setting. Monitor client progress and adjust treatment interventions based on clinical needs and engagement in telehealth services. Identify clinical and case management needs, coordinating care remotely and connecting clients with appropriate virtual or local support services. Facilitate psychoeducational and process groups via secure video platforms, maintaining engagement and therapeutic effectiveness in a virtual environment. Coordinate or arrange for necessary toxicology screenings (e.g., urine drug screens) through approved local labs or partner facilities, and review results as part of ongoing care. Demonstrate working knowledge of opioid use disorders and provide or support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T) in collaboration with prescribing providers when applicable. Ensure compliance with all applicable Medicaid, Medicare, and telehealth regulations, including documentation, billing, and privacy standards (e.g., HIPAA). Maintain up-to-date knowledge of community resources and virtual support options to assist with discharge planning and aftercare coordination. Utilize electronic health record (EHR) systems and telehealth technologies effectively while maintaining accurate and timely clinical documentation.
